Everything is fine, I liked the product, I bought it for a reason.

I considered bringing a DSLR camera, but ultimately decided against it since (1) I lack the initiative to plan picture sessions and (2) it would be lazy of me to lug around half a pound of iron with a protruding lens on every walk. A larger matrix or lower resolution in terms of mega pixels is preferable. Yes, and it works out rather nicely with ISO80, the stabilizer set to its second mode, and some practice. Advantages that vary The "soap box's" 10x zoom lens has excellent aperture. camera lens that can be used to steady moving images. Good enough performance when set to automatic. There are user-manageable options. Easy on/off switch for the light. Negatives: Distinct skewing and other irregularities are seen. Vignetting would have been horrifying if the original 10MP image hadn't been cropped down to 9MP (darkening in the corners). But, the situation is dire for ultra-hyperzooms.
